A. Students are encouraged to acquire teaching experience during their career as a PSI student because it is integral to professional growth and marketability.
B. However, neither the department nor the PSI program have a formal teaching requirement.
C. Summer and semester teaching opportunities supplement the Steinhardt fellowship.
D. Opportunities for teaching are available through various Departments in Steinhardt (e.g., Applied Psychology, Teaching & Learning, Applied Statistics, Social Science and Humanities) and in Arts & Science (e.g., Psychology, Sociology).
The department of Applied Psychology has yearly open positions for some PhD students to serve as Teaching Assistants or Instructors. Every year, a survey is sent out to assess student interest in teaching opportunities.
Students should discuss with their primary mentors about when and how to incorporate teaching experience into their professional development.
